Newport date pencilled in by bilingual musician

The Welsh singer/songwriter, Bronwen Lewis, is on her 'More From The Living Room' tour and is due to appear in Newport in mid-June.

This bilingual multi-instrumentalist hails from Neath and has been playing both guitar and piano since early childhood. She delivers an eclectic mix of folk, country and blues in her own individual and inimitable style.

Bronwen first came to public attention in 2013 on the BBC talent show The Voice, with an acclaimed rendition of Sting's 'Fields of Gold' that included a verse in the Welsh language. It sparked the interest of leading music executives.

She subsequently recorded the 'Bread and Roses' theme song from the BAFTA-winning film 'Pride', and also featured in the movie. Lockdown saw her go viral on Tik Tok, giving 45 concerts that amassed over 500,000 views in total. Her talents have more recently been showcased on DJ Greg James's BBC Radio One Breakfast Show.

After the success of last year's tour, Bronwen is now back live onstage, and is set to perform a combination of original material, some Welsh music, recent hits as well as her own personal favourite tracks.
